How many types of coordinate systems are there in AutoCAD?

There is 4 AutoCAD coordinates system you should know. Absolute coordinate system, Relative Rectangular coordinate system, Relative Polar coordinate system and Interactive system(Direct coordinate system).

Which type of coordinate system used in AutoCAD?

MicroStation and AutoCAD use 2D and 3D Cartesian coordinate systems that locate data at fixed coordinates. X-, y-, and z-coordinates are not inherently geographic locations; instead they are locations relative to an arbitrary geometric origin (0,0,0).

How many types of coordinate systems are there?

Data is defined in both horizontal and vertical coordinate systems. Horizontal coordinate systems locate data across the surface of the earth, and vertical coordinate systems locate the relative height or depth of data. Horizontal coordinate systems can be of three types: geographic, projected, or local.

What is abscissa and co ordinate?

In common usage, the abscissa refers to the horizontal (x) axis and the ordinate refers to the vertical (y) axis of a standard two-dimensional graph.

What is a coordinate system in math?

Coordinate system, Arrangement of reference lines or curves used to identify the location of points in space. … Points are designated by their distance along a horizontal (x) and vertical (y) axis from a reference point, the origin, designated (0, 0). Cartesian coordinates also can be used for three (or more) dimensions.

What are examples of CAD?

Examples of CAD software

  • AutoCAD, 3ds Max, and Maya — commercial CAD software titles published by Autodesk.
  • Blender — an open-source CAD, animation, and image processing application with an active community of users.
  • SketchUp — a proprietary CAD application that runs in a web browser, formerly developed by Google.
